Professional Certificate in Emergency Health and Safety in Social Care holds immense significance in today's market, particularly in the UK. According to the Health and Safety Executive (HSE), there were 655,000 reported work-related injuries, illnesses, and deaths in the UK in 2020-21. This highlights the importance of having the right skills and knowledge to manage emergency situations in social care settings.

Year Number of Work-Related Injuries
2020-21 655,000
2019-20 648,000
2018-19 644,000
